Tabla de contenido:
2025 Autor: John Day | [email protected]. Última modificación: 2025-01-23 14:39
Proyectos Tinkercad »
El filtro de paso bajo es un excelente circuito electrónico para filtrar las señales parásitas de sus proyectos. Un problema común en proyectos con Arduino y sistemas con sensores que trabajan cerca de los circuitos de energía es la presencia de señales “parásitas”.
Pueden ser causados por vibraciones o campos magnéticos en la misma área que el sensor.
Estas señales, que en su mayoría son de alta frecuencia, provocan perturbaciones en el momento de la lectura y, en consecuencia, se producen lecturas erróneas en el sistema de automatización. Un ejemplo común es el arranque de una máquina que requiere una alta corriente inicial.
Esto provocará la generación de ruido de alta frecuencia en varios elementos que están conectados a la red eléctrica, incluidos los sensores.
Para evitar que estos ruidos afecten al sistema, se utilizan filtros entre el elemento sensor y el sistema que lo lee.
¿Qué son los filtros pasivos y activos?
Suministros
- 2 resistencias;
- 2 condensadores cerámicos
- 2 condensadores electrolíticos;
- Amplificador operacional LM358
- Terminales de alimentación o batería de 9V;
Paso 1: ¿Qué son los filtros pasivos y activos?
Los filtros son circuitos que pueden "limpiar" una señal, separar las señales no deseadas, para evitar leer valores que no coinciden con la realidad.
Los filtros pueden ser de dos tipos: pasivos y activos.
Filtros pasivos Los filtros pueden ser pasivos, que son los más simples, ya que constan solo de resistencias y condensadores.
Filtros activos
Los filtros activos, además de resistencias y condensadores, utilizan amplificadores para mejorar el filtrado y filtros digitales, que se utilizan en procesadores y microcontroladores.
Por lo tanto, en este artículo aprenderá:
Comprender cómo funciona el filtro de paso bajo;
Configure el hardware del filtro de paso bajo con una frecuencia de corte de 100 Hz utilizando un amplificador operacional LM358;
Calcule los valores de los componentes pasivos del circuito;
Montar un filtro de paso bajo NextPCB.
A continuación, presentamos el proceso de desarrollo del filtro paso bajo activo para nuestros circuitos con Arduino.
Paso 2: Desarrollo del circuito RC del filtro de paso bajo activo
En este proyecto se desarrollará un filtro paso bajo activo con NEXTPCB - Printed Circuit Board, es decir, que nos permita pasar bajas frecuencias. El rango de frecuencia a elegir depende del funcionamiento del circuito.
Para este artículo utilizaremos un filtro de paso bajo activo, ya que se utilizan para frecuencias inferiores a 1MHz, y, además, se puede realizar la amplificación de la señal, ya que se utilizará un amplificador operacional en este circuito.
Por lo tanto, en base a este proyecto, el enfoque central estará en el desarrollo del circuito de filtro de paso bajo activo y su circuito de suministro simétrico. La figura 1 ilustra el hardware de este circuito.
Se puede acceder al circuito RC del filtro de paso bajo construido en TinkerCAD en el siguiente enlace:
Como se mencionó, usamos Arduino en este proyecto para adquirir la señal de un sensor. Por lo tanto, el circuito RC del filtro de paso bajo en la figura anterior tenemos 3 partes importantes:
- El generador de señales,
- El filtro activo y;
- Arduino para recopilar datos de sensores.
El generador de señales se encarga de simular el funcionamiento de un sensor y transmitir la señal al Arduino. Esta señal luego se filtra a través del filtro de paso bajo RC y, posteriormente, la señal filtrada es leída y procesada por Arduino.
Así, para realizar el montaje del filtro paso bajo RC necesitaremos los siguientes componentes electrónicos:
- 2 resistencias;
- 2 condensadores cerámicos
- 2 condensadores electrolíticos;
- Amplificador operacional LM358
- Terminales de alimentación o batería de 9V
A continuación, presentamos el cálculo de los valores de las resistencias y condensadores del circuito. El cálculo de estos componentes se basa en la frecuencia de corte del filtro de paso bajo del filtro activo.
Cálculos de resistencias y condensadores
Para el circuito propuesto, usaremos una frecuencia de corte de filtro de paso bajo de 100Hz. De esta forma, el circuito permitirá que las frecuencias pasen por debajo de 100Hz y por encima de 100Hz, la señal disminuirá exponencialmente.
Por tanto, para el cálculo de condensadores tenemos: Inicialmente, basta con definir un valor de C1, en cuyo caso se puede definir un valor comercial de 1 a 100nF.
A continuación, realizamos el cálculo del condensador C2 de acuerdo con la siguiente ecuación.
Luego, use la fórmula siguiente para calcular el valor de R1 y R2. La fórmula se puede utilizar para proyectar el valor de las dos resistencias. A continuación, vea el cálculo realizado.
Donde f * C es la frecuencia de corte del filtro de paso bajo, es decir, por encima de esa frecuencia, la ganancia de esta señal disminuirá. El valor de f * C para este sistema será de 100 Hz.
Por lo tanto, tenemos el siguiente valor de resistencia para R1 y R2.
A partir de los valores obtenidos para las resistencias y el condensador del proyecto, debemos desarrollar el circuito de alimentación del filtro activo. Para este tipo de filtro, necesitamos utilizar fuente de alimentación asimétrica y, a continuación, presentaremos el circuito de alimentación.
Paso 3: la fuente de alimentación
La potencia requerida para este circuito es una fuente de alimentación simétrica. Si no tiene una fuente de alimentación simétrica, monte un circuito con condensadores alimentados por una fuente de alimentación simple.
Sin embargo, el valor de voltaje de la fuente de alimentación debe ser superior a 10 V, ya que el valor de la fuente simétrica se dividirá por 2.
La figura anterior muestra el circuito de la fuente de alimentación.
Este circuito ya está en el diagrama electrónico de la Figura 1, ya que se utiliza una fuente no simétrica común.
Después de diseñar el circuito de filtro activo y su circuito de suministro, desarrollamos un módulo de filtro electrónico para ser utilizado en sus proyectos con Arduino o en otros proyectos que necesiten un filtro para este propósito.
A continuación, presentaremos la estructura del esquema electrónico y el diseño de la placa electrónica desarrollada.
La placa de circuito impreso del filtro de paso bajo activo RC
Paso 4: La placa de circuito impreso del filtro de paso bajo activo RC
Para hacer la placa de circuito impreso electrónico - NEXTPCB, se desarrolló el esquema electrónico del circuito. El esquema electrónico del filtro de paso bajo activo RC se muestra en la Figura 3.
Luego, el esquema se exportó al diseño de PCB del software Altium y se diseñó la siguiente placa, como se muestra en la Figura 4.
Se utilizaron tres pines para suministrar el circuito y la señal de entrada y dos pines en la salida. Los dos pines se utilizan para la salida de la señal filtrada y el GND del circuito.
Después de diseñar el diseño de la PCB, se generó el diseño 3D de la placa de circuito impreso y se presentó en la Figura 5.
Desde el proyecto de PCB, puede usar este módulo y aplicarlo a su proyecto con Arduino. De esta forma, se cancelarán determinadas señales parásitas y su proyecto funcionará sin riesgo de errores en la lectura de la señal.
Conclusión
Este circuito RC de filtro de paso bajo activo puede ser ampliamente utilizado para filtrar la potencia del Arduino, filtrando las señales de comunicación serie, como en la radiofrecuencia, que suele tener muchas señales que suelen provocar interferencias en la comunicación serie, siempre que el valor de se cambia la frecuencia de corte.
Un consejo después de montar este circuito es acercar la conexión al Arduino, ya que buena parte de la interferencia está en la distancia entre el sensor y el microcontrolador, y en la mayoría de los casos, el microcontrolador no puede estar muy cerca, porque la ubicación de el sensor puede ser dañino para el Arduino.
Además, para tener una señal más continua, simplemente cambie la frecuencia de corte del filtro de paso bajo a una frecuencia más baja, esto cambiará los valores de las resistencias y condensadores. También tiene sus ventajas de crear una ganancia en la señal, si la señal es baja.
Información importante
Se puede acceder a todos los archivos en el siguiente enlace: Archivos de la placa de circuito impreso
Puede obtener sus propios 10 PCB y pagar solo el flete en la primera compra en el NextPCB. Disfrute y utilice este proyecto con sus proyectos y sensores Arduino.
Recomendado:
Motor paso a paso controlado por motor paso a paso sin microcontrolador (V2): 9 pasos (con imágenes)
Motor paso a paso controlado por motor paso a paso sin microcontrolador (V2): En uno de mis Instructables anteriores, le mostré cómo controlar un motor paso a paso usando un motor paso a paso sin un microcontrolador. Fue un proyecto rápido y divertido, pero vino con dos problemas que se resolverán en este Instructable. Entonces, ingenio
Filtro pasivo de paso bajo para circuitos de audio (filtro RC de forma libre): 6 pasos
Filtro pasivo de paso bajo para circuitos de audio (filtro RC de forma libre): una cosa que siempre me ha dado problemas al hacer instrumentos electrónicos personalizados es la interferencia de ruido persistente en mis señales de audio. Probé blindaje y diferentes trucos para las señales de cableado, pero la solución más simple después de la construcción parece ser b
Modelo de locomotora controlada por motor paso a paso - Motor paso a paso como codificador rotatorio: 11 pasos (con imágenes)
Locomotora modelo controlada por motor paso a paso | Motor paso a paso como codificador rotatorio: en uno de los Instructables anteriores, aprendimos cómo usar un motor paso a paso como codificador rotatorio. En este proyecto, ahora usaremos ese motor paso a paso convertido en codificador rotatorio para controlar un modelo de locomotora usando un microcontrolador Arduino. Entonces, sin fu
Motor paso a paso controlado por motor - Motor paso a paso como codificador rotatorio: 11 pasos (con imágenes)
Motor paso a paso controlado por motor paso a paso | Motor paso a paso como codificador rotatorio: ¿Tiene un par de motores paso a paso por ahí y quiere hacer algo? En este Instructable, usemos un motor paso a paso como codificador rotatorio para controlar la posición de otro motor paso a paso usando un microcontrolador Arduino. Así que sin más preámbulos, vamos a
LP-2010 AES17 1998 Filtro de paso bajo del amplificador de conmutación (paso bajo): 4 pasos
LP-2010 AES17 1998 Filtro de paso bajo del amplificador de conmutación (paso bajo): Este es un gran amplificador de clase D para medir el filtro de paso bajo. rendimiento de alto costo